Abstract
The utility model relates to backlight FPC lighting technology fields, and disclose a kind of automatic lighting mechanism of backlight FPC, including fixed frame, the lower end inner wall of the fixed frame is equipped with translation machine translation mechanism, the upper end of the translation mechanism is equipped with PCB circuit board elevating mechanism, and the inner sidewall of the fixed frame is also provided with backlight FPC draw frame machine.The automatic lighting mechanism of backlight FPC can reduce personnel's cumbersome operation manually, need to only place product to locating slot, and the docking FPC with PCB circuit board of automatic and accurate is capable of in mechanism, to reach efficient quick operation.

Background technique
The current common external FPC interface of backlight is normally on the outside of backlight, and product F PC lighting (automatic & is manual) is all
There is preferable visible space to remove observation product F PC and PCB circuit on state, have part backlight be better space utilization and
FPC is designed at the product back side.
FPC is located at back side product, and common be connected with PCB circuit board is all to start product at present, and then staff is manual
FPC and PCB circuit board enter grafting, is also that staff transfers to it after the completion of test, greatly increases personnel's operation
The cumbersome process of journey, to influence operation production capacity.For this purpose, the invention proposes a kind of automatic lighting mechanisms of backlight FPC.
